    on the mods note……(I used to work for DL many moons ago) a modification is/was classed as anything not on the original spec – so if they want to be @rsey then optional extras are mods. Now, I would never declare a panoramic roof or optional alloys or the like, but that’s not to say that it’s not technically fraud (in the most minor sense of the word).

    I heard some interesting arguements in my time with policy holders dropping things like “I went for the bigger wheels” into a conversation, the price then jumps 10% and everyone gets a tad upset!

    Did you change the top hats without changing the DU bush? If so I would get these changed out too as they should always wear out faster than the top hats (the DU bush is supposed to be the sacrificial part).

    There’s always some play in the mounting bolts when they are loose, otherwise they’d be an absolute mare to install!
